I took all the measures as you suggested and able to get around 10
transactions per second with 60% of CPU. As you said, signing is taking
little more CPU. ( Tested with and without signing of saml response ).
however, the base CPU usage without signature/verification(no signature on
request/response) itself is high.
signed request/response - 9.4tps
unsigned request - 10.4tps
usigned request/response - 13.7tps
We are thinking the saml request xml parsers in shibboleth COTS might be
consuming more CPU. If we want use any other XML parser, what are the
configurations we need to consider.
